TYRES SAVED MY LIFE!

WHEN Bongani Khumalo moved to zone 24 Sebokeng three years ago, neighbours gave him some friendly advice.
“Put some old tyres on your roof,” they said.
And today he thanks the tyres and believes they saved his life.
He claimed lightning mysteriously struck on a day with clear blue skies as he was strolling leisurely into his house.
Still in shock, he  he had been sitting outside on Saturday and was going inside to watch TV.

But before he could sit down on his chair, something very strange happened.
The 34-year-old Bongani said: lightning came from nowhere and struck the house!
“Everything inside the house shook and the lights and the TV went off as I dropped on the ground,” claimed Bongani.
He said there had been no sign of rain or even clouds in the sky.
“The tyres really saved my life. Fortunately, I was alone in the house as my partner had gone away for the weekend with our child.”
Most houses in the newly established zone 24 have tyres on their roofs, and all of them for the same reason.
Bongani said at first he thought the tyres were to strengthen the roof so that it didn’t get ripped off by strong winds.
He said he now understood the real reason.
“Whether natural lightning or some sent by evil people, at the end of the day my family and I are all safe,” he said
